Light Shade Option
Selecting light colors for your paint can substantially boost the illusion of space within your artwork. Light shades such as soft pastels, whites, and light grays have the ability to mirror even more light, making a space feel even more open and airy. These shades produce a sense of expansiveness, making walls appear to decline and ceilings appear greater.
By utilizing light colors on both wall surfaces and ceilings, you can obscure the boundaries of the room, providing the perception of a larger location.
In addition, light shades have the power to jump all-natural and artificial light around the room, brightening dark corners and casting fewer shadows. This result not only adds to the general roomy feeling yet likewise creates a much more welcoming and dynamic ambience.
When selecting light colors, consider the touches to make certain harmony with other components in the space. By strategically including light shades into your painting, you can change a restricted area right into a visually bigger and more inviting atmosphere.
Strategic Trim Painting
When intending to develop the illusion of room in your painting, tactical trim painting plays a vital role in defining limits and boosting deepness understanding. By strategically picking the colors and coatings for trim work, you can successfully control just how light communicates with the space, inevitably affecting how big or tiny an area feels.
To make an area show up bigger, take into consideration repainting the trim a lighter color than the wall surfaces. This contrast produces a feeling of deepness, making the walls decline and the space feel even more expansive.
On the other hand, painting the trim the exact same shade as the wall surfaces can develop a smooth look that blurs the edges, offering the illusion of a continuous surface and making the limits of the area much less defined.
Additionally, making use of a high-gloss coating on trim can reflect more light, further boosting the understanding of area. Alternatively, a matte coating can soak up light, producing a cozier ambience.
Thoroughly considering these information when repainting trim can significantly influence the overall feeling and perceived dimension of a space.
Visual Fallacy Techniques
Making use of optical illusion techniques in painting can efficiently modify assumptions of depth and space within a provided setting. One usual technique is making use of gradients, where colors transition from light to dark tones. By applying a lighter shade on top of a wall and gradually dimming it towards all-time low, the ceiling can show up greater, producing a feeling of vertical space. Alternatively, painting the flooring a darker color than the wall surfaces can make it feel like the room prolongs additionally than it in fact does.
An additional optical illusion method involves the critical positioning of patterns. Straight red stripes, for instance, can aesthetically widen a slim area, while vertical stripes can lengthen an area. Geometric patterns or murals with viewpoint can likewise deceive the eye right into regarding even more depth.
In addition, including reflective surfaces like mirrors or metal paints can bounce light around the room, making it feel extra open and spacious. By skillfully employing these visual fallacy techniques, painters can change small rooms right into aesthetically extensive areas.
